A. K. Rit, P. Shanmugam, R. Natarajan, Tube Investments Of India Limited, Chennai, India
Vacuum heat treatment process has got a world wide acceptance as an alternative to atmosphere heat treatment process. There is a tremendous increase in use of vacuum heat treating in last decade because of reduced distortion and clean product obtained from this process. In this paper, vacuum carbo-nitriding with high pressure gas quenching for heat treating smaller parts like “stepped bush” is explored. The bush is made out of SAE5120. A comparison between Batch integral quench furnace and vacuum furnace for heat treating smaller parts are discussed. Metallurgical and physical aspects of the heat treated products are analyzed and found that vacuum furnace has shown better results. Inter granular oxidation is absent in vacuum heat-treated products in this investigation. Distortion analysis is carried out on these heat treated products for the two furnaces. The merits and drawbacks between these two heat treatment furnaces for heat-treating smaller parts are discussed in this paper.
